Can I get a settlement for pain and suffering after a car accident?
Yes, you can get a settlement for pain and suffering after a car accident in Florida. This type of settlement is known as a non-economic damages award. Non-economic damages are awarded to compensate an injured person for losses that are not easily quantifiable like medical bills or lost wages. In Florida, the first step in recovering non-economic damages is to prove that the other party acted negligently. This means that they did something unreasonable or careless that caused the accident. You have to show that their actions directly caused the accident and your ensuing injuries. To recover non-economic damages, you will need to provide evidence of your injury. This can include medical records, doctor reports, photos of the accident, and any other documents that might help prove that you suffered pain and suffering as a result of the accident. In Florida, you must also show that you suffered a permanent injury as a result of the accident. This means that your injury must affect your daily life and have long-term physical, psychological or emotional effects. Non-economic damages are difficult to quantify, so an experienced personal injury attorney can help you calculate what your pain and suffering settlement should be. They can also help you to negotiate a fair settlement from the other party’s insurance company.
